The Position
Global Competitive Intelligence Manager/Sr Manager, Infectious Deceases
Based in South San Francisco or Basel
Global Competitive Intelligence Manager/Sr Manager - Key Activities:
¿ As a member of the Global Strategic Analytics Team, the successful candidate will be an important strategic business partner to the global marketing teams; International Business, Lifecycle, Disease Area Strategy teams and Roche Partnering.
¿ Works in close collaboration with the International Business Analyst, generating synergies within Strategic Analytics for GPS and the Roche organization
¿ Responsible for cross-functional collaboration to determine competitive landscape for both development and marketed products
¿ Defines and frames business challenges and decision requirements with key stakeholders based on a clear understanding of client needs and priorities. Works with key internal stakeholders and International Business Analyst (IBA) to develop, update and answer key intelligence topics and questions
¿ Leads the collection of competitor information and competitive intelligence from internal and external sources (both published and unpublished) and undertakes the synthesis, analysis and dissemination of this information to support strategic decision making.
¿ You will be responsible for conducting international Competitor Intelligence projects using a variety of methodologies.
¿ Monitors key competitors and ensures timely dissemination of critical intelligence and associated recommendations to appropriate stakeholders.
¿ Leads the coordination, planning and execution competitive coverage at conferences
¿ Proactively promote best CI practice within Roche
Creates an environment of strong team spirit, excellent communication, high motivation and inspires other team members to achieve goals in line with Roche strategies
Who You Are
You're someone who wants to influence your own development. You're lookingfor a company where you have the opportunity to pursue your interests acrossfunctions and geographies, and where a job title is not considered the finaldefinition of who you are, but the starting point.
- You are likely to have an advanced science or business degree, an MBA is preferred/desirable
- You are an excellent communicator, fluent in English, with a minimum of 5 years work experience of which at least 3 years in the area of marketing/market research/analysis in the pharmaceutical industry, experience in the area of Virology/Inflammation would be an advantage.
- Track record of integrating and synthesizing findings from multiple sources to enable informed strategic decision making
- You are proactive in taking the initiative and responsibility.
- Your strong analytical and numerate skills are matched by good oral and written communication skills, and you have a track record of successfully influencing multicultural and multidisciplinary teams.
